I thank the Leader for putting forward the Commencement Matter on student nurses' pay. I selected it because it is such an important issue. There are too many nurses emigrating because of their experience in our health system while they are trainee nurses and student nurses.

On the issue of climate action, I hope that we could include it on our schedule. I was at a foreign affairs committee meeting in the same week the Pope said climate change was a risk to humanity and the Pentagon said it was a bigger threat than global terrorism. If the Pentagon is saying that the issue of climate change is a bigger threat to humanity's existence than global terrorism then we do have an issue.
